Police have arrested four suspects who allegedly robbed a 7-Eleven shop in Chon Buri’s Sri Racha district.

 

Provincial Police Bureau 2 commissioner Pol Lt-General Jitti Rodbangyang held a press conference at the Sri Racha district police station on Monday to announce the arrests.

 

The four suspects, who were arrested Sunday, were identified as Piyapong Inritm, 32, Supawan Kongmun, 19, and two boys aged 18 and 16.

 

Police investigated and made the arrest after a man with full crash helmet hiding his face robbed a 7-Eleven shop in front of Wat Na Prao in Tambon Surasak at 2.30am on Saturday and fled on one of two motorcycles waiting for him outside.

 

He used a long knife to force the cashier to give him Bt7,400 in cash and three packets of cigarettes.

 

Police checked the motorcycles’ licence plates and arrested the four at their houses.
